如何以编程方式更改视口尺寸(就像 DevTools 那样?)

如何以编程方式更改视口尺寸(就像 DevTools 那样?)

使用响应式视口在 Devtools 中查看网站时,您可以自定义屏幕尺寸(以像素为单位)。这是根据 CSS/JS 规则在浏览器端完成的吗?还是屏幕尺寸会发送到网站服务器,然后服务器做出适当响应?如果是后者,那么这些信息是如何发送的 - 它是用户代理、标头、HTML 标签还是其他内容的一部分?

我的目标是使用 UserScript 之类的东西显示具有自定义视口尺寸的网站,并且没有使用 DevTools 或物理调整浏览器窗口大小。

相关内容